Income Statement | Dec 24 | Dec 23 | Dec 22 | Dec 21 | Dec 20 |
---|---|---|---|---|---|
$ 1.67B | $ 1.83B | $ 1.95B | $ 2.03B | $ 1.66B | |
$ 555.40M | $ 598.30M | $ 552.30M | $ 614.90M | $ 492.40M | |
$ 365.70M | $ 553.60M | $ 418.20M | $ 438.90M | $ 369.10M | |
$ 0.00 | $ 76.10M | $ 79.40M | $ 85.70M | $ 70.70M | |
$ -37.00M | $ 121.60M | $ 139.90M | $ 243.40M | $ 188.10M | |
$ -37.00M | $ 44.70M | $ 159.80M | $ 151.00M | $ 112.40M | |
$ -50.30M | $ -57.80M | $ -19.90M | $ -39.60M | $ -33.80M | |
$ -87.30M | $ -13.10M | $ 14.90M | $ 111.40M | $ 78.60M | |
$ -101.60M | $ -21.80M | $ -13.20M | $ 101.90M | $ 62.00M | |
$ ― | $ ― | $ ― | $ ― | $ ― | |
$ -1.06 | $ -0.23 | $ -0.14 | $ 1.07 | $ 0.65 | |
$ -1.06 | $ -0.23 | $ -0.14 | $ 1.05 | $ 0.65 | |
95.60M | 95.30M | 95.30M | 95.50M | 94.90M | |
95.60M | 95.30M | 95.30M | 97.10M | 96.10M |